Publisher's Synopsis

The continuation of Hick's Road: Jacob's Story, as told by the journal of Ann Miller.


Picking-up moments after Ann and Jacob part ways during a battle with the Hand of Transcendence, Ann mitigates the new challenges she faces with her surrogate Skitcha family and aristocratic upbringing. Aspiring to a position in the government, Ann questions the status-quo as a woman of the 1850s while working secretly on behalf of the tribe in a case against the reconstruction of the Quicksilver Mining Company. While protecting the spiritual roots of the Skitcha, Ann finds herself confronted by a mysterious group of businessmen who jeopardize the safety of Almaden Valley when they plan to construct a road that could divide the powers of the land as they know it. Presented with these threats, Ann must carve her own path as she fights for her family, the land, and the future of the tribe.
